ZenaTech's Innovative Use of Quantum Computing
ZenaTech, Inc. (NASDAQ: ZENA) is making great strides in technology with its groundbreaking initiatives in AI drone technology and Quantum Computing. The company recently announced an agreement to acquire a third land survey engineering company, significantly expanding its capabilities in the Western US. This development aims to improve wildfire tracking and management through advanced technology solutions combined with drone services.

The Advantages of Drone as a Service (DaaS)
ZenaTech's Drone as a Service (DaaS) model offers businesses a cost-effective solution for utilizing advanced drone technology without the need for extensive initial investments or training. This pay-as-you-go system allows various sectors, including agriculture and logistics, to deploy drones for tasks such as inspection and monitoring, thereby enhancing operational efficiency.
Efficient Land Surveying Techniques
In land surveying, ZenaTech's drones are equipped with sophisticated sensors, cameras, and GPS systems that enable rapid data collection over large areas. This method is significantly faster compared to traditional surveying techniques, which can take weeks or even months. By promoting quicker and more accurate land assessments, ZenaTech is revolutionizing how businesses and governments approach infrastructure development.
